Laurel has gone 4-0 against East Central recently and they'll look to pad the win column further on Wednesday. The Laurel Golden Tornadoes will be playing at home against the East Central Hornets at 6:30 p.m. The teams are on pretty different trajectories at the moment (Laurel has ten straight victories, East Central has five straight losses), but none of that matters once you're on the court.
Last Monday, everything came up roses for Laurel against Stone as the squad secured a 74-27 win. Given the Golden Tornadoes' advantage in MaxPreps' Mississippi basketball rankings (they are ranked 65th, while the Tomcats are ranked 228th), the result wasn't entirely unexpected.
Meanwhile, East Central played a tough game on Tuesday in which they were outscored in every quarter. They lost 66-42 to Vancleave.
Laurel pushed their record up to 17-7 with the victory, which was their ninth straight at home. The wins came thanks to their offensive performance across that stretch, as they averaged 60.2 points per game. As for East Central, their defeat dropped their record down to 3-15.
Everything came up roses for Laurel against East Central in their previous matchup on January 3rd, as the team secured a 65-32 win. In that matchup, Laurel amassed a halftime lead of 52-23, an impressive feat they'll look to repeat on Wednesday.
